یک جدول به نام employees با ستونهای id از نوع INTEGER، name از نوع VARCHAR(100) NOT NULL، email از نوع VARCHAR(255) NOT NULL و hire_date از نوع DATE ایجاد کنید.
0.0 بازدید آخرین ویرایش در 221 روز قبل ساعت 01:12 0.0
مسئله را با استفاده از دستور CREATE TABLE در SQL حل کنید و برای ستونهایی که نباید مقدار NULL داشته باشند از عبارت NOT NULL استفاده کنید؛ این کار در هر پایگاه داده رابطهای رایجی مثل MySQL، PostgreSQL یا SQLite مشابه است. برای اطمینان میتوانید پس از ایجاد جدول با دستورهایی مانند DESCRIBE employees (یا \d employees در PostgreSQL و PRAGMA table_info در SQLite) ساختار ستونها را بررسی کنید و با اجرای یک INSERT بدون مقدار برای ستونهای NOT NULL، رفتار را تست کنید تا مطمئن شوید محدودیتها اعمال شدهاند.
1 پاسخ
جدید ترین قدیمی ترین بالاترین امتیاز پاسخ های من
در حال بارگیری...
برای ارسال پاسخ باید با حساب کاربری وارد شوید.
ورود به حساب کاربری
برای ایجاد جدول employees با ستونهای id، name، email و hire_date، از دستور CREATE TABLE با تعریف NOT NULL برای name، email و hire_date استفاده کنید و مقدار id را بهعنوان کلید اصلی و خودکار افزایشدهنده تعریف کنید (مثلاً SERIAL در PostgreSQL یا AUTOINCREMENT در MySQL). پس از ایجاد، با ابزارهایی مانند DESCRIBE (یا \d در PostgreSQL و PRAGMA table_info در SQLite) ساختار ستونها را بررسی کنید و با تلاش برای INSERT ناقص برای ستونهای NOT NULL، صحت محدودیتها را تست کنید. همچنین توصیه میشود ایمیل را UNIQUE کنید تا از تکراری بودن دادهها جلوگیری شود. در نظر بگیرید اندازه VARCHAR مناسب است و برای ایمیل طول 255 کاراکتر کافی است.
گزارش